The First World War Memorial in St. Peter's Church, Monkwearmouth (Sunderland)

Inside St. Peter's Church, Monkwearmouth (Sunderland) is a Book of Remembrance for the parishes of St. Peter's and St. Cuthbert's. This Book of Remembrance records the names of 125 parishioners of St. Peter's and 44 names of parishioners of St. Cuthbert's who lost their lives in the First World war.
The Book of Remembrance is housed in a wooden display case. The names of those commemorated in this book have been transcribed on the North East War Memorials Project website.
4 soldiers who served in the Yorkshire Regiment are commemorated in the memorial book.
Private John Morton, 16639. 6th Battalion Yorkshire
Regiment. Killed 29 September 1916.
Born Newcastle, Enlisted Sunderland.
Commemorated on Pier and Face 3A & 3D, THIEPVAL MEMORIAL.
(John Morton's Pension
Record Card shows that his widow, Elsie, was living in Monkwearmouth.)
Private John Newton. 21115. 7th Battalion Yorkshire
Regiment. Killed 1 July 1916.
Born Sunderland, Enlisted Sunderland.
Buried FRICOURT BRITISH CEMETERY.
Commemorated on the FRICOURT MEMORIAL.
(The 1911 Census shows that John Newton was married to Mary Elizabeth (plus
4 children) and living at 107 Church Street, Monkwearmouth. He was aged 28
in 1911.)
Private Thomas Henry Renney. 15061. 8th Battalion Yorkshire
Regiment. Son of Thomas Henry Renney, of 33, Victor St., Monkwearmouth, Sunderland.
Killed 10 July 1916. Aged 27.
Born Sunderland, Enlisted Sunderland, Resided Monkwearmouth.
Commemorated on Pier and Face 3A & 3D, THIEPVAL MEMORIAL.
Private Clement Rose. 15734. 8th Battalion the Yorkshire
Regiment. Son of John George and Mary Rose, of 19, Hamilton St., Monkwearmouth,
Sunderland. Enlisted 13th Oct., 1914. (Exactly 1 year ago, when only 17).
Killed 13 October 1915. Aged 18.
Born Monkwearmouth (Sunderland), Enlisted Sunderland, Resided Monkwearmouth.
Buried DESPLANQUE FARM CEMETERY.
